Decoding Emotions: AI's Journey into the Realm of Feeling
The sphere of human emotions has long been a enigma for researchers. Traditionally, understanding feelings relied on subjective interpretations and complex psychological analysis. But now, artificial intelligence (AI) is venturing on a remarkable journey to interpret these abstract states.
Advanced AI algorithms are employed to interpret vast archives of human actions, searching for trends that align with specific emotions. Through machine learning, these AI systems are learning to recognize subtle signals in facial expressions, voice tone, and even textual communication.
- Ultimately, this revolutionary technology has the possibility to transform the way we interpret emotions, providing valuable insights in fields such as mental health, education, and even interaction design.
The Human Touch: Where AI Falls Short in Emotional Intelligence
While artificial intelligence rapidly a staggering pace, there remains a crucial area where it falls short: emotional intelligence. AI algorithms can't to truly understand the complexities of human emotions. They lack the capacity for empathy, compassion, and intuition that are vital for navigating social interactions. AI may be able to analyze facial expressions and inflection in voice, but it fails to truly feel what lies beneath the surface. This intrinsic difference highlights the enduring value of human connection and the irreplaceable influence that emotions play in shaping our lives.
